Granudacyn
Rinsing solution and gel for cleaning, moisturizing and rinsing
Granudacyn is an irrigation solution for cleaning and moisturizing acute, chronic, and contaminated wounds, as well as first- and second-degree burns. The hypochlorous acid (HOCl) it contains ensures safe preservation and makes Granudacyn a reliable wound irrigation solution.
Granudacyn can be used for the careful cleaning, moistening, and rinsing of the following wounds:
- All chronic wounds of any depth, such as diabetic foot ulcers, pressure ulcers, venous leg ulcers, etc.
- All acute wounds, such as cuts, bites, lacerations, and abrasions.
- Surgical wounds (intraoperative and postoperative).
- Wounds with exposed cartilage, tendons, ligaments or bones.
- Burns up to degree 2.
- Radiation ulcers.
- Fistulas and abscesses.
- Body cavities such as the ear, nose, mouth, throat and pharynx.
- Critically colonized or infected (here adjuvant) wounds.
- Soft tissue injuries.
Granudacyn can also be used to moisten wound dressings and to remove wound dressings and wound pads.
Granudacyn is suitable for multi-patient use for up to 90 days (gel) and 60 days (solution) after opening. To ensure safe use after opening, Granudacyn contains a preservative that occurs naturally in the body: hypochlorous acid. Hypochlorous acid also prevents the growth of gram-positive and gram-negative bacteria, including MRSA, ORSA, VRSA, VRE, viruses, fungi, and spores in the solution (= sterility).
- It cleans the wound mechanically.
- Germ-free and pH-neutral.
- Non-cytotoxic or irritating, free of heavy metals.
- Hypotonic to promote osmolysis and cell growth.
- Reduces wound odor.
